Date:Sunday 5 May 1940
Time:
Type:Silhouette image of generic L8 model; specific model in this crash may look slightly different    
Luscombe 8A
Owner/operator:Private
Registration: NC….
MSN:
Fatalities:Fatalities: 1 / Occupants: 1
Aircraft damage: Destroyed
Location:Near Kildare, OK -   United States of America
Phase: En route
Nature:Private
Departure airport:Ponca City, OK
Destination airport:
Narrative:
Hit a schoolhouse while flying low and crashed, pilot had been drinking at a party all night before starting on this flight.
